How they compare

Qatar currently reports 107.9% against 107.3% in Pakistan, a difference of 0.6%.

Across all 14 years both countries report, Qatar has been ahead every year.

Pakistan ranks 48th and Qatar ranks 47th of 184 countries.

Qatar has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Pakistan Qatar Difference Ahead
2000s 95.1% 108.4% 13.3% Qatar
2010s 97.5% 106.5% 9.0% Qatar

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Gross intake ratio in first grade of primary education is the number of new entrants in the first grade of primary education regardless of age, expressed as a percentage of the population of the official primary entrance age.
